Thanks for the help with my new aquarium setup ( filter questions and tank setup and cycling ) Here are the 3 imported 6" to 7" Japanese KOI I took from my pond, so I could keep them at 70 degrees to allow them to grow during the winter.

Red - White ( Nidan Kohaku )
Black - Orange (Ki Utsurii )
Yellow ( Doitsu Yamabuki Ogon )

These KOI are straight out of japan ( 50$ a pop 5" to 6" )... Most LFS have domestic koi that where breed in the USA ( The USA is catching up, but japan is number one for this type of fish ) Where do you live and I could get some info for you on a koi farm near you....

BTW, i dont think it is a yamabuki either, hmm, looks more like a hikarimoyo. Is it ALL yellow? or does it have markings. because:
ogon means solid coloured
and yamabuki means yellow

Hmm, i live all the different varieties. You may have a cross bred koi.
